AEW All In London is going down in Wembley Stadium on August 27th, but AEW is going right back to their fans’ wallets one week later for All Out on September 3rd. Now, we know a big match for that show.

Ruby Soho is the only member of the Outcasts who is not wrestling at All In London. Saraya and Toni Storm are in a four-way for the AEW Women’s Title with Hikaru Shida and Britt Baker. There was some thought about adding Soho to the All Out card, but that’s not happening now.

It was revealed during AEW Collision that Ruby Soho challenged Kris Statlander to a TBS Title match at All Out. This will give another match to the September card, but that means the match isn’t going down in Wembley Stadium.

We will have to see what else AEW adds to All Out. Tony Khan likes to book massive cards, and the All Out card only has a few matches so far.
